"This is part one of our school life words. So let's start with the word school. In Chinese it is xue xiao. Xue xiao. Xiao means the place that we study, and xue is study. So this is the literal meaning of xue xiao in Chinese. Ok. Xue. Xiao. The right part of xiao is the pronunciation part, and with xue xiao let's learn another word. Go to school. It's shang xue. Shang is go to. School - xue. Here it represents xue xiao, it represents a school. Ok, let's write xue xiao and shang xue together. Xue xiao - school, and go to school is shang xue. So in Chinese, xue, this character we use it to indicate xue xiao to mean school."
